Neuropsychological care for children
2 – 18 years old

We are skilled in assessment of autism spectrum disorder, complex ADHD, intellectual disability, developmental coordination disorder, complex learning disorders (e.g., dyslexia, dyscalculia, dysgraphia), and a range of diagnoses related to communication, mood, anxiety, and behavior.

Our Services

Neuropsychological Assessment

Understand the functioning of your child's

brain areas and systems

​

We gather information about intellectual functioning, attention and concentration, learning, memory, executive functioning, fine motor skills, social skills, mood, anxiety, and behavior. 

Neurodevelopmental Assessment

Understand your toddler or preschooler's developmental progression

​

This assessment is tailored to identify the specific strengths and any potential developmental delays or developmental diagnoses in a child 2-5 years old. We evaluate language, fine motor, behavior, emotion, and social skills.

Psychological Assessment

Understand your child's emotions,

behaviors, and personality

​

Your child might benefit from a psychological assessment if they are presenting with emotional distress, challenging or changing behaviors, or difficulty socializing.

Academic Assessment

Understand your child's educational achievement and school-based needs

​

This assessment addresses goals in one of the major areas of your child’s life: school. We determine a child’s educational performance and needs across reading, writing, and mathematics, with specific focus on your areas of concern.
